Output 6583b3e856f30d5076feda5b8cd23bf2878d1f2103c3e0c48a7869422e42e221:0

value
42974
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3cbf234b15467f321c352a46b7ece275d3e370a3 OP_EQUALVERIFY OP_CHECKSIG
address
16YCX15wUPAV3ER4W6ku8aAxw2fViNvrpt
transaction
6583b3e856f30d5076feda5b8cd23bf2878d1f2103c3e0c48a7869422e42e221
confirmations
386205
spent
true